Sam Darnold is looking for a new team in the 2025 season after the Minnesota Vikings declined to franchise-tag him, clearing the way for them to begin the JJ McCarthy era. But his latest suitors don't quite instill most fans' confidence.

On Sunday, The Athletic's Dianna Russini reported that the Pittsburgh Steelers are planning to extend an offer to the Pro Bowl quarterback once the tampering period opens on Tuesday. Both quarterbacks, Russell Wilson and Justin Fields, are set to hit free agency on Wednesday:

Sam Darnold, who set career-highs in nearly every relevent passing category in the 2024 season, has also been linked with the Seattle Seahawks, who traded erstwhile-starter Geno Smith to the Las Vegas Raiders on Friday. Sports Illustrated's Ryan Phillips wrote:

"The Seahawks look like a near-perfect fit for Darnold. The scheme matches his abilities, and Seattle is ready to win now."

However, the organization is also set to meet with Aaron Rodgers, who will leave the New York Jets after two seasons.


Other free-agency options for Sam Darnold besides Steelers and Seahawks

Yahoo's Charles Robinson, meanwhile, sees two more options for Sam Darnold as he enters free agency.

One is, surprisingly enough, the Vikings. One anonymous agent claimed:

“I just think Darnold’s market is a lot softer than people realize, and his best setup is going to be staying in Minnesota another year.”

Sources say that the best deal for him would be $25-30 million annually to remain in Minneapolis for one or two years. However, that will be contingent on negotiations with the likes of Aaron Rodgers and Daniel Jones failing.

A slightly more realistic option would be the New York Giants, who have been rumored to want to trade up to No. 1 overall and select Cam Ward. But they are also eyeing Rodgers and Russell Wilson after Matthew Stafford spurned them by restructuring his contract with the Los Angeles Rams:

"If the Giants can’t find a path to drafting Ward, this could be where Darnold gets the franchise QB deal that was expected over the course of last season."

The new league year begins on March 12.
